This project simulates the communication system in MATLAB program based on pulse position modulation (PPM) technique, and by using correlation technique for synchronization. This technique avoids the detection of bits by using a threshold value. Then, an optical wireless communication transmission system is developed using low-cost hardware based on the concept of software-defined radio/communication. The involved hardware includes a Field Programmable Gate Array (FPGA) board, a digital-to-analog converter (DAC), and a light emitted diode (LED) light source.
